With a substantial portion of the market place being HFT, it's no wonder that we get runs up and down that nail very heavy support/.resistance areas then turn, rinse, repeat.

One of the strategies that's been working is to be out of the market until your vehicle of choice runs into these and starts to turn. Looking a VXX/XIV are a perfect example of this, IMO. In the past, VXX has split when it spends a bit of time below 13. We ran straight into that area and then exploded upward. Not a coincidence.
